About Mr Philip Mortimer
Mr Philip Mortimer is an osteopath. They are registered with the General Osteopathic Council (GOsC). Osteopathy is a safe and effective form of healthcare for a wide range of conditions. Osteopaths use a variety of techniques to diagnose and treat musculoskeletal problems. Osteopaths use a holistic approach to healthcare, which means they consider the whole person, not just their symptoms. They are trained to identify the underlying causes of pain and dysfunction, and to develop individualised treatment plans. Osteopathic treatment is often used to help relieve pain, improve mobility and restore function.
